Output 5782910c68c6be52479c512ac77c08a4dbd28389e8ec1ee8e53fc7ddb73c2d0e:0

value
1335736
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71ed93289c1b7ecce56352aa8e26411eb36dd47e OP_EQUAL
address
3C5QtD7rXZJWJoujPXcXGktqYSyZjYfphS
transaction
5782910c68c6be52479c512ac77c08a4dbd28389e8ec1ee8e53fc7ddb73c2d0e
spent
true